Defqon.1 Festival 2027: Rise of the Weekend Warriors
Defqon.1 Festival 2027 summons the global hard dance tribe back to the Holy Grounds in Biddinghuizen, Netherlands, for another monumental celebration of power, unity and uncompromising sound. Created by Q-dance, this legendary gathering transforms its vast festival landscape into a spectacular world of towering stages, thunderous sound systems, pyrotechnics and unforgettable show moments.
Since its first edition in 2003, Defqon.1 has evolved from an underground gathering into the defining international festival for the harder styles. Its colour-coded stages explore every corner of hard dance, from euphoric hardstyle and rawstyle to hardcore, uptempo, frenchcore and early classics. The mighty RED stage forms the beating heart of the festival, while areas such as BLUE, BLACK, MAGENTA, INDIGO, GOLD and YELLOW each deliver their own distinctive atmosphere and intensity.
The official 2027 line-up has yet to be announced, but fans can expect an enormous programme combining established pioneers, modern headliners and fast-rising artists from across the global harder-styles scene. Defqon.1 is renowned not only for individual performances but also for its defining rituals. The Gathering welcomes Weekend Warriors into the experience, Power Hour unleashes sixty minutes of choreographed madness, and the Closing Ceremony brings the tribe together for an emotional final celebration beneath lasers, flames and fireworks.
Beyond the main stages, the festival grounds are filled with pop-up performances, interactive challenges, merchandise stores, food courts and unexpected adventures. After the daytime arenas close, The Wasted Lands keep the energy alive with afterparties, silent discos, bonfires and late-night gatherings across the camping area.

BY PUBLIC TRANSPORT
From Amsterdam Centraal take the train to Dronten (1h 15 min journey) and then take the Bus to Biddinghuizen (17 min journey).

BY PLANE
Amsterdam Schiphol Airport (AMS) is the closesest to the Venue. From the airport take the train to Lelystad Centrum (48 min journey) and then take the train to Dronten (12 min journey). You can then take the Bus to Biddinghuizen (17 min journey).
